How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Radial Hills?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Radial Hills Studio Apartments | $1,175 | $685 | $2,450 |
Radial Hills 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,265 | $735 | $2,950 |
Radial Hills 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,731 | $750 | $3,950 |
Radial Hills 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,043 | $1,395 | $4,000 |
Radial Hills 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,000 | $2,000 | $2,000 |

What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
